Friday Favorites - Writers & Graveyards

Last Saturday we spent a lovely day exploring an old graveyard in Concord, MA and nearby Walden Pond with some new friends.  The graveyard is called Sleepy Hallow and is home to the graves of some famous writers, such as Emerson, Thoreau and Alcott.  It was an awesome place to take pictures, so I thought I'd share a few of my favorites today.
